Hello all,

     I am considering the purchase of a set of plans for the KR-2S but before 
committing, I wanted to get a look at a construction manual.  Recently I got a 
crack at just that: a KR-1 manual and plan-set from Rand Robinson Engineering 
which looked like they were from the early 70's seemed abysmally short on 
details.  FYI, the plans number was KR-1 # 6215.  The vagueness of this 
document set was a bit discouraging, leaving me with a definite sense of 
disconnect between the pretty pictures I had before me and my vision of the 
detailed drawings and written instruction I feel I will need to get through 
this project.

     Now that the material comes from NVAero and multiple decades have passed, 
can I assume the level of detailed information and quality of the direction in 
the manual has evolved (improved)?
